首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

python-函数与函数式编程

函数与函数式编程介绍 在过去,大家广为熟知的编程方式无非就两种:面向对象和面向过程,不论是哪一种,它们都是编程的一种规范或者是如何编程的方法论。而现在,一种更为古老的编程方式:函数式编程,以其不保存状态,不修改变量等特性重新进入我们的视野。下面就一起了解一下这一传统的编程理念。

1、面向对象和面向过程

面向对象---》类---》class

面向过程---》过程---》def

函数式编程---》函数---》def

函数和过程都是可以调用的实体,不同:过程就是没有返回值的函数而已,函数有返回值。

运行结果:

2、编程语言中函数定义:函数是逻辑结构化和过程化的一种编程方法。

3、为什么要使用函数

.可重复利用,提高代码可用性

.可扩展性

.一致性

运行结果:

点个赞呗!!!

  • 发表于:
  • 原文链接https://kuaibao.qq.com/s/20190128A0ULB500?refer=cp_1026
  • 腾讯「腾讯云开发者社区」是腾讯内容开放平台帐号(企鹅号)传播渠道之一,根据《腾讯内容开放平台服务协议》转载发布内容。
  • 如有侵权,请联系 cloudcommunity@tencent.com 删除。

扫码

添加站长 进交流群

领取专属 10元无门槛券

私享最新 技术干货

扫码加入开发者社群
领券